Climate in San Antonio, Texas

San Antonio, Texas, is a city known for its warm climate, with temperatures exceeding 90º F in the summer. The River City has a humid subtropical climate, which means mild winters and hot summers.

The average temperature in San Antonio throughout the year is 70° F. However, depending on the season, temperatures vary considerably.

Throughout the summer, temperatures can reach 100° F, so it is important to drink plenty of fluids and avoid spending long periods of time outdoors during the hottest parts of the day. In contrast, temperatures in San Antonio during the winter are mild, averaging around 50° F.
